I have a weird problem intermittently with the keyboard. In certain apps (most notably Obsidian, Firefox and vim) certain keys are ignored at times. I’m not sure if the issue affects all apps, but these are the ones I’m using the most and have noticed the problem in.
I thik it’s the same keys always. The ones I found out have the problem: i and l, the arrow keys as well as numbers (the numbers are also the ones located above the three letter rows of the keyboard, so it’s not a numlock issue).
What I noticed happens when I press the keys and they get ignored: they don’t actually get ignored - when pressing the icon of the active app lights up like this:
I noticed a peculiar thing about the task manager: When the keys work as expected (type) it looks like this:

From what I can guess, the keys don’t work when the app isn’t fully regarded as the active window so Plasma tries to switch the window (but it’s always the active app that lights up, regardless of the key pressed. When the keys work the task manager lights indicate the same as they do when the keys don’t work properly (holding an affected key makes the bar under the icon light up, which lasts for about a second after the key is released as well).
